-1.#IND
double연산을 하다 보면, 가끔 출력이 제대로 안 되고 -1.#IND라는 것이 출력될 때가 있다. 이게 뭐지? 하고 찾아봤는데, 이런 이런, 이놈의 MSDN은 제대로 설명이 안 나온다.(이것도 포럼 뒤지면 나오겠지만.) 에 역시 그러면 구글신님이다 싶어, 검색해보니, 아뿔사. -, .,#은 구글 검색에서 제외되고, 남은게 1하고 IND인데, 제대로 나오는 게 없더라 뭐 그래도 계속 찾아보니 결과는 나왔다. 내 성격에 꽤나 자주 할 실수 같으니 잊어 먹지 않도록 적어놔야지. 예상은 했지만 생각보다 좀 황당하다. 답은 NaN (Not a Number) 즉 숫자가 아니다. 표시할 수 없는 숫자. 이런 게다. 그래서 double 주제에 NaN이 되는 숫자가 뭔가 했는데, 1. 초기화 되지 않은 숫자, (IN..